史书上的日期是怎么算出来的,比如剑龙元年六月的贵由?

干部分支法

使用分支和分支记录每日订单的方法。干支是天干和地支的合称。它和干支年表一样,以干支相配的60个甲子来记录日序,从甲子开始到桂海,以60天为一周。《干支纪日》始于商代,但其顺序至今未断或混乱,有待考证。目前已知2600多年,从春秋时期鲁隐公三年(公元前720年)二月四日到清代宣彤三年(1911年)(民国元年1912年采用历年后,民间仍沿用)。干支纪年法是商代历法的最大成就,是目前世界上已知最长的纪年法。对于中国历史特别是科技发展史的考证和研究来说,它是极其重要的计时符号,是珍贵的科学文化遗产。如《菜之战》:“夏四月,辛巳以菜败秦军。”“四月辛巳”指的是农历四月十三;《石钟山纪》“元丰七年六月丁丑”,即农历六月九日“登泰山”指的是本月28日。古人也用天干或地支来代表特定的日子。比如《礼记·谭公》中的“子茂不乐”,“子茂”指的是一个邪恶的日子或禁忌的日子。

将公元日期转换为树干和树枝日期的公式:

g = 4C+[C/4]+5y+[y/4]+[3 *(M+1)/5]+d-3

z = 8C+[C/4]+5y+[y/4]+[3 *(M+1)/5]+d+7+I

其中c是世纪数减一,y是年份的后两位数(如果是1月和2月,当前年份减一),m是月份(如果是1月和2月,分别按照13和14计算),d是天数。奇数月i=0,偶数月i=6。g除以10的余数是天干,z除以12的余数是地支。计算时,带[]的数字表示小数点后四舍五入。

比如查2011 1 18。将数值代入计算公式。

g = 4 *(21-1)+[20/4]+5 * 10+[10/4]+[3 *(13+1)/5]。

z = 8 * 20+[20/4]+5 * 10+[10/4]+[3 *(13+1)/5]+18+7+0 =答案为:2011 1 18,干支日为贵由日。